<tr><td><center><b>Monitor Negotation</b></center>

Marine Aquarium 2.0 accesses DirectX using all the correct/documented function calls as prescribed by Microsoft. This may result in an increased number of "clicks" of the relay in your monitor as this negotiation is taking place, especially if you are running your display in 32 bit color and the Aquarium is set to 16 bit color.

One solution is to set the Aquarium to also run in 32-bit color and/or your Desktop Resolution.
